What problem does it solve?

Orchestrates rigorous, multi-perspective reviews by coordinating specialized judges to critique completed work, identify gaps, and surface actionable improvements.

Core Features & Use Cases

  • Multi-Agent Debate: parallel judges independently assess work and propose findings
  • LLM-as-a-Judge: uses a structured evaluation framework to ensure consistency
  • Consensus Building: debates findings to reach supported recommendations
